Subject Yesterday's Viral Video of child attacked by an eagle was a hoax!!!
Poster Handle Aristide Torchia
Post Content
A sensational video showing an eagle seizing a young child, distraught social networks. Several news sites have fallen into the trap before its authors, four students in digital design, do not confirm it was a joke.

The video shows the raptor, a bird of two meter wingspan, flying in circles above the park.

Then suddenly seen poking out of a young child, caught by his suit and remove a few meters before releasing it in the grass.

We hear the man who filmed swearing, then rush to comfort the child who cries but does not appear to have been injured. End of the sequence.

The effect was immediate: in a few hours the document has been seen over a million times, 1,200,000, according to its authors.

The instructions accompanying the video states that the scene takes place in Parc du Mont-Royal in Montreal and the raptor is a golden eagle.

Before the digital joke is brought to light, these two points have been confirmed by a biologist Claude Drolet, who works in the park as head of conservation services for a non-profit organization, Friends of the Mountain.

"It is 50 meters from my office at the Smith House," he said, and the bird could be an eagle, some recognizable white wing feathers.

That said, the video tour probably in November, was described as "staged" by the biologist. "It is unrealistic that the person whose child is attacked is not the Smith House to ask for help and educate people."

Very quickly, seasoned observers have pointed the net disturbing details to conclude that the video is a fake.

A still image of rapacious in its approach phase shows that its wings disappears in many ways, the shadow of the raptor is not always present on the ground and the baby's body has a surprising behavior when it is released by the bird, as if floating in the air for a moment.

There was still some suspense, it was lifted Wednesday afternoon by a statement from the National Animation and Design (NAD), which offers courses in 3D animation and visual effects, design and digital arts.

The video in question, he says, was produced by Normand Archambault, Loïc Mireault, Rye and Félix Antoine Marquis-Poulin, student at the NAD Centre in the course "Simulation Workshop production" Bachelor of Animation 3D digital design.

"The child and the eagle were created in 3D animation by students and then integrated into a real shooting," he says.

It is in the same course that was produced a year ago a similar video showing a penguin walking around Montreal. He seemed larger than life, but then again, it was a hoax.
